Ingenta Past Earnings Performance

Past criteria checks 4/6

Ingenta has been growing earnings at an average annual rate of 62.1%, while the IT industry saw earnings growing at 15.5% annually. Revenues have been declining at an average rate of 3.6% per year. Ingenta's return on equity is 47.5%, and it has net margins of 22.3%.

Quality Earnings: ING has a high level of non-cash earnings.

Growing Profit Margin: ING's current net profit margins (22.3%) are higher than last year (19%).


Free Cash Flow vs Earnings Analysis


Past Earnings Growth Analysis

Earnings Trend: ING's earnings have grown significantly by 62.1% per year over the past 5 years.

Accelerating Growth: ING's earnings growth over the past year (24.8%) is below its 5-year average (62.1% per year).

Earnings vs Industry: ING earnings growth over the past year (24.8%) exceeded the IT industry 11.3%.


Return on Equity

High ROE: ING's Return on Equity (47.5%) is considered outstanding.
